Transaction 579e47525d1483a0819297000400ab10820562aa9ec8590e3966a2ef52f7e650
1 Input
1 Output
-
579e47525d1483a0819297000400ab10820562aa9ec8590e3966a2ef52f7e650:0
- value
- 78535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99dd53592fc84c6c1d64480e3b98bd467ff16a3f OP_EQUAL
- address
- 3FiaSs724UZToxHNdkoXhSMJEUQpmSRvSW